A casting that moves from Obstruction into Deliverance means the situation you asked about is not static — it begins as one pattern and resolves into another. The first hexagram describes where you stand; the second describes where events are carrying you.
Highlighted in red: lines 2, 3, 4 and 5 are moving — counted from the bottom. A moving line is where the change is actually happening: it flips from yang to yin or back, and that flip is what turns Obstruction into Deliverance.
The situation: Hexagram 39, Obstruction
A gorge ahead, a mountain behind. Reroute, don't ram.
Deep water in front, steep mountain behind — the direct road is genuinely closed, and this hexagram respects you enough to say so. Pushing forward now means drowning in the effort; the obstacle is real, not a mindset problem. So change the geometry. Go around, go back, go get help — this is a strong moment for allies, mentors, and anyone who knows the terrain. Take the easy direction, not the heroic one. And use the stall well. Obstruction forces the reflection that open roads never do. What you rethink here, you keep.
Structurally, Obstruction is Mountain below Water — the inner state meeting the outer condition. That pairing is the lens for everything above.
Where it's heading: Hexagram 40, Deliverance
The storm breaks. Release, forgive, and move on quickly.
The changed hexagram is the trajectory, not a verdict. As the moving lines settle, the energy of Obstruction gives way to Deliverance (Xie) — Water below Thunder. The advice that belongs to this outcome: Close the old matter fast, forgive it fully, start the next thing now.
